Description

white powder Lindane is a white to yellow, crystalline powder with a slight, musty odor (pure material is odorless). BHC is a white-to-brownish crystalline solidwith a musty, phosgene-like odor.

Lindane Use and Manufacturing

Insecticide. Used to control pests such as rice, wheat, soybeans, corn, vegetables, fruit trees, tobacco, forests, granaries, etc.
